+/**
+ * Master-owned manager of the durable Lance index job records, the same-name
+ * fences, and the three-level unresolved-job quotas. It deliberately reuses
+ * neither the generic JobManager scheduling framework nor the internal
+ * IndexChangeJob machinery: the external one-shot CAS, no-redispatch rule,
+ * same-name fence, and possible-live ownership required here are not provided
+ * by either.
+ *
+ * <p>Every FE keeps the same in-memory image of {@link #jobs}: the master
+ * writes each durable transition to the edit log and then applies the same
+ * record locally; followers apply it from replay. All transitions share one
+ * write-path shape:
+ * <pre>
+ * writeLock -&gt; validate (state, revision CAS, callback identity)
+ *           -&gt; writeEditLog(updated copy)   // fails only by System.exit
+ *           -&gt; applyToMemory(updated copy)  // verbatim swap + fence/quota 
accounting
+ * </pre>
+ * A published {@link LanceIndexJob} is never mutated; a transition stages a
+ * copy, logs it, and swaps it in. {@link #replayUpsertJob(LanceIndexJob)} is a
+ * verbatim replace with a monotonic-revision guard and performs no state
+ * transformation at all: a follower tailing a live master must keep a fresh
+ * RUNNING record RUNNING. The only place a durable RUNNING without a complete
+ * matching terminal result becomes UNKNOWN is {@link #onTransferToMaster()},
+ * the master-election sweep that runs after metadata replay and before any
+ * dispatcher could start.
+ *
+ * <p>Fence and quota live and die together ({@link 
LanceIndexJob#isUnresolved()}):
+ * released when a known terminal job's refresh is NOT_REQUIRED or DONE, or by
+ * a durable FORCE_RELEASE; an unresolved UNKNOWN holds both across failover,
+ * timeout, termination proof, and metadata observations.
+ *
+ * <p>The class starts no threads, so no checkpoint-thread guard is needed in
+ * the constructor; the derived fence index and quota counters are rebuilt in
+ * {@link #gsonPostProcess()} after image load.
+ */

Review Comment:
   Could we keep admission fail-closed when an unresolved replayed record lacks 
fence identity? This branch stores a PENDING/RUNNING/UNKNOWN job but omits it 
from both the fence/quota books and getUnresolvedJobs(). After replay, a new 
job for the same real target can therefore pass admission and be dispatched 
even though the old mutation may still be live or may already have committed. 
That conflicts with the core invariant that ambiguous outcomes retain the 
fence. Since the key cannot be reconstructed, please introduce a global 
corrupt-unresolved admission blocker (or fail replay/startup) instead of 
silently excluding this record from the books.
